最近公司业务需要安装个OGG做数据同步,也是踩了很多坑花了四天才搭建好,网上相关的帖子并不是很多,一些细节问题被提及的也很少。所以整理了下自己这次搭建OGG工具的经验,以及其中可能会遇到的一些坑及相关解决方法。oracle源端和postgresql目标端服务器都要安装对应的OGG,postgresql还需额外安装ODBCPostgres驱动下载对应OGG软件分别上传至各自服务器1.1.创建Gold
Egg.js 是什么?Egg.js 为企业级框架和应用而生,我们希望由 Egg.js 孕育出更多上层框架,帮助开发团队和开发人员降低开发和维护成本。基于 Koa 开发,性能优异, 框架稳定,测试覆盖率高的框架注:Egg.js 缩写为 Egg设计原则Egg 奉行『约定优于配置』我们深知企业级应用在追求规范和共建的同时,还需要考虑如何平衡不同团队之间的差异,求同存异。所以我们没有选择社区常见框架的大集
目录1.环境介绍2.实验步骤:2.1创建`OGG`操作系统用户2.2修改`OGG`操作系统用户环境变量2.3创建`OGG`安装目录2.4上传`OGG`安装介质2.5登录`OGG`测试2.6建立`OGG`表空间(两个库都做)2.7创建`OGG`用户2.8为`OGG`用户授权2.9必须开归档,打开数据库的附加日志和`force log`2.10运行`OGG`支持`DDL`脚本2.11创建`OGG`的
1 两种模式的限制:https://docs.oracle.com/goldengate/c1221/gg-winux/GIORA/system-requirements-and-preinstallation-instructions.htm#GIORA1362 经典模式静默安装示例文件https://docs.oracle.com/goldengate/c1221/gg-winux/GI...
原创 2021-09-08 09:37:46
281阅读
OGG(Oracle Golden Gate)软件是一种基于日志的结构化数据复制备份软件,它通过解析源数据库在线日志或归档日志获得数据的增量变化,再将这些变化应用到目标数据库,从而实现源数据库与目标数据库同步。Oracle Golden Gate可以在异构的IT基础结构(包括几乎所有常用操作系统平台和数据库平台)之间实现大量数据亚秒一级的实时复制,从而在可以在应急系统、在线报表、实时数据仓库供应、
转载 2023-07-12 18:00:57
200阅读
OGG安裝部署 文章目录OGG安裝部署1、环境准备2、下载3、安裝部署3.1 源端3.1.1、解压安装3.1.2、 配置OGG环境变量3.2 目标端3.2.1、解压4、oracle打开归档模式4.1、 Oracle打开日志相关4.2、 oracle创建复制用户5、OGG初始化5.1、Oracle创建测试表5.2、OGG源端配置5.2.1、配置OGG的全局变量5.2.2、 配置管理器mgr5.2.3
转载 2024-03-07 15:54:25
43阅读
当前Kubetnetes已经成为容器编排领域事实的行业标准,越来越多的公司选择使用Kubernetes来搭建其容器云平台。本次分享主要介绍滴滴弹性云在围绕Kubernetes打造企业级私有云过程中的一些实践经验和教训,为同样正走在企业云化转型道路上的朋友们提供一些启发和帮助。 当前滴滴国际化业务全部运行在弹性云平台上,国内的顺风车,金融,汽车后市场、企业安全、客服以及专车快车等业务的全部或部分
一、常用命令:1、启动GoldenGate进程(1)首先以启动GoldenGate进程的系统用户(一般为oracle)登录源系统。(2) 进入GoldenGate安装目录,执行./ggsci进入命令行模式。(3) 启动源端管理进程GGSCI > start mgr(4) 同样登陆到目标端GoldenGate安装目录,执行./ggsci,然后执行GGSCI > start mgr启动管理
转载 2023-10-17 20:41:17
490阅读
一、系统概述Oracle Golden Gate (简称OGG)是一种基于日志的结构化数据复制备份软件,它通过解析源数据库在线日志(redo log)或归档日志(archive log)获得数据的增量变化,再将这些变化应用到目标数据库,从而实现源端数据库与目标端数据库同步。OGG可以实现不通平台(包括不通操作系统,数据库)实现大量数据亚秒一级的实时复制,从而可以在业务连续性保障、在线报表、数据仓库
转载 2023-10-31 11:31:21
59阅读
今天遇到一个朋友需要做一个mysql到oralce 的ogg同步测试,正好利用他的环境测试了一下myql到oracle表的数据同步。下面给出测试的环境mysql:5.7.25   oracle:11.2.0.4测试同步数据:mysql mytest库下test 表同步到 oracle test用户下test1表中去ogg版本这里我选择了19C ogg,下载连接如下:https:
转载 2024-07-02 20:48:06
283阅读
1.使用场景公网连接适用于开发或辅助管理数据库,对于正式的业务场景建议您采用内网方式连接,避免数据库被入侵或攻击等不可控因素而导致连接不可用。2.实现原理将公网IP绑定到同一网段的主机,通过该主机转发公网请求到数据库来实现公网对数据库的访问。3.具体实现步骤3.1.安装docker最新docker的安装方案:安装docker成功后,然后启动docker。systemctl start docker
转载 2024-10-28 22:07:24
44阅读
经过这段时间的实践练习,我对经典版21c的部署操作步骤进行了一些总结。整体架构首先了解了OGG的整体架构 OGG OGG配置项源端目标端数据库初始配置YY管理进程YY提取进程YN投送进程YN检查点表Y复制进程Y通过上面的表格可以大致了解需要在源端和目标端部署OGG组件步骤纲要(1)首先分别在源端和目标端安装OGG软件,配置环境变量,完成工作目录初始化(2)第二步,分别在源端和目标端进行数
转载 2024-10-12 08:13:28
65阅读
一、osg库基本数据类,负责提供基本场景图类:渲染绘制、场景节点管理、图形绘制、渲染状态管理等。包含一些程序所需要的特定功能类,如命令行解析和错误调试信息等。#include <osg/Node>/*节点类*/ //继承关系:osg::Node-osg::Object-osg::Referenced #include <osg/Node> //类中方法 Node() //默
转载 2024-10-10 15:45:28
194阅读
1. OGG简介OGG 是一种基于日志的结构化数据复制软件,它通过解析源数据库在线日志或归档日志获得数据的增删改变化(数据量只有日志的四分之一左右)OGG 能够实现大量交易数据的实时捕捉,变换和投递,实现源数据库与目标数据库的数据同步,保持最少10ms的数据延迟。2. 应用场景高可用容灾数据库迁移、升级(支持跨版本、异构数据库、零宕机时间、亚秒级恢复)实时数据集成(支持异构数据库、多源数据库)3.
转载 2024-08-21 22:42:41
168阅读
1. OGG 手工切换trail文件测试ogg中断之后,重新同步操作https://www.cndba.cn/leo1990/article/2839  OGG 修改 trail 文件大小https://www.cndba.cn/leo1990/article/2856alter extract pump1 etrollover SEND extract ext1, ROLLOVER
转载 2024-08-07 21:42:04
154阅读
RACà单机复制配置1.1  环境简介性质IP系统ORACLE版本源端10.123.112.201/10.123.112.202LINUX rhel5 64位10.2.0.1目标端10.123.112.235LINUX rhel5 32位10.2.0.1  1.2  源端安装OCFS2集群文件系统RAC环境中为了实现高可用性,需将OGG安装在集群文件系统中,
        本文参考<<osg最长一帧>>, <<OpenSceneGraph三维渲染引擎编程指南>>, <<OpenSceneGraph三维渲染引擎设计与实践>> 。场景相关: Node, Geode, Group, Transform, L
转载 2023-11-19 08:06:49
81阅读
OGG:Oracle Golden Gate 文章目录OGG:Oracle Golden Gate1.OGG的特点:2.OGG的工作原理:   简称为OGG,提供异构环境下的数据的实时捕捉,变换和投递。 1.OGG的特点:对生产环境影响较小,因其实时读取交易日志从而实现了用最小的资源占用解决了大交易量数据的实时复制。以交易为单位复制,保证交易的一致性实现了只同步提交的数据。高性能,智能的交易重组
转载 2024-01-26 08:42:39
53阅读
研究了两天的OSGI,对于这两天的学习进行一个简短的总结。 OSGi是什么 OSGi——Open Service Gateway Initiative 字面上的意思是一个公共的服务平台。OSGi亦称做Java语言的动态模块系统,它为模块化应用的开发定义了一个基础架构。简单说,它是是一个动态模块化框架的规范,提供了插件化、面向服务和插件扩展三大功能。这个规范体现非常重要的2点:“
转载 2023-12-07 09:14:57
43阅读
# OGG实时架构简介 Oracle GoldenGate (OGG) 是一款用于实时数据集成和复制的解决方案,能够帮助用户在不同系统之间高效地同步数据。对于刚入行的小白来说,了解OGG的工作流程以及如何实施实时数据复制是非常重要的。本文将详细介绍OGG的总体架构,并提供实施步骤及相关代码示例。 ## OGG总体实施流程 下面是OGG实施的基本流程: | 步骤 | 描述 | |------
原创 10月前
97阅读
  • 1
  • 2
  • 3
  • 4
  • 5